USDA Secretary Brooke Rollins was one of the featured speakers at the annual Ag Outlook Forum last week and she addressed the difficulties of the farm economy. Rollins, whose plane back to DC was grounded, addressed the 101st Ag Outlook Forum virtually and said that she aims to get billions in farm disaster aid allocated quickly.

Rollins says you cannot ignore the struggles of the current ag economy.

Rollins says she’s committed to turning things around, starting with disaster aid approved by Congress.

Rollins says USDA is moving at “light speed” to disburse aid and meet or beat Congress’ March 21st deadline. Rollins also pledged to continue the fight against avian influenza, pointing to a newly unveiled billion-dollar containment plan designed to re-populate flocks, improve biosecurity, and drive vaccine research.
